Fredrick (Fred) Matthew Nugent, went home to his creator on May 24, 2016, at the Good Shepherd Hospice. He was born on December 13, 1939 in Detroit, Michigan. He was preceded in death by parents Leo and Gertrude Tallman Nugent; brother Harold H. Nugent; and son Michael Patrick Nugent. Fred...
